The Art of Composition and Lighting
Great visual content starts with impeccable composition and lighting. Natural light is often your best friend, illuminating food beautifully without harsh shadows. Position your dish near a window, using diffusers if the light is too direct. For composition, apply principles like the rule of thirds, leading lines, and negative space to draw the eye to your focal point. Experiment with different angles – overhead shots for intricate plating, or close-ups for delicious textures.

Elevating with Props and Styling
Props and styling transform a dish into a scene. Choose plates, cutlery, linens, and backgrounds that complement your food without overpowering it. A minimalist approach can highlight the dish itself, while a richer setting can tell a story about the cuisine or occasion. Consider using fresh herbs, a sprinkle of spices, or a drip of sauce to add dynamic interest. Pay attention to color theory; complementary colors can make your food pop, while monochromatic schemes can evoke elegance.

Capturing Motion and Emotion (Video Bites)
While static images can be stunning, short-form video is king for scroll-stopping content. Think about what movements evoke a sensory response: a slow drizzle of honey, a sizzling pan, steam rising from a hot dish, or the gentle sprinkle of garnish. Capture the process – chopping, mixing, plating – to immerse your audience. Don’t forget to include the human element: hands interacting with food, a reaction shot of someone enjoying a bite. These add authenticity and emotion, resonating deeply with foodies.

The Power of Post-Production and Storytelling
Editing is where your Visual Bites truly come alive. Adjust colors, contrast, and sharpness to enhance the natural beauty of your food. For videos, judicious trimming, adding speed ramps, and incorporating engaging music or voiceovers can dramatically increase impact. But beyond technical tweaks, focus on storytelling. What is the narrative of this dish? Is it comfort food, a gourmet experience, or a quick weeknight meal? Let your editing guide the viewer through this story quickly and compellingly.
